MEDITECH’s 2017 Physician and CIO Forum is being held October 18-19 at MEDITECH’s Foxborough, Massachusetts facility. Last year’s event approached maximum capacity, so, if you are considering attending, it would be wise to register as soon as possible. MEDITECH has published the agenda and there are six breakout sessions to allow maximum participation. There are 36 topics covered in these sessions, including a number presented by NHA active and recent clients (note that some organizations are conducting presentations on multiple topics).
